Steps:
- 1. Brown beef and onion in a large skillet over medium high heat, for about 5 minutes.
- 2. Stir in tomatoes, soy sauce, chili powder, and 1 1/2 cups of water. Bring to boil, reduce heat and simmer, covered for 5 minutes.
- 3. Stir in macaroni, cover and simmer for 10-12 min or until macaroni is tendered, yet firm, stirring once.
